Ben & Jerry's Ice Cream Pints

Created by: Howcan Team

Ingredients

  • 2 cups heavy cream
  • 1 cup whole milk
  • 3/4 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1/2 cup mix-ins (chocolate chips, cookie dough, nuts, etc.)

Instructions

  • In a large mixing bowl, whisk together 2 cups of heavy cream, 1 cup of whole milk, and 3/4 cup of granulated sugar until the sugar is dissolved.
  • Stir in 1 teaspoon of vanilla extract.
  • Pour the mixture into an ice cream maker and churn according to the manufacturer's instructions, usually about 25-30 minutes, or until the ice cream reaches a soft-serve consistency.
  • During the last few minutes of churning, add 1/2 cup of your favorite mix-ins, such as chocolate chips, cookie dough, or nuts.
  • Transfer the churned ice cream to airtight pint containers and freeze for at least 4 hours, or until firm.
  • Scoop and enjoy your homemade Ben & Jerry's ice cream straight from the pint!

Ben & Jerry's Ice Cream Pints have a rich history dating back to 1978 when childhood friends Ben Cohen and Jerry Greenfield opened their first scoop shop in Burlington, Vermont. Their unique and creative flavors quickly gained popularity, leading to the production of their iconic pint-sized ice cream containers. The brand's commitment to using high-quality, natural ingredients and their dedication to social and environmental causes have made Ben & Jerry's a beloved household name. Today, their pints are available in a wide range of flavors, from classic favorites like Cherry Garcia to innovative creations like Half Baked.
